Frequently asked questions about the 27

What time is the first and last 27 bus?
The first 27 of the day departs at 05:55 and the last one departs at 22:45. These are the scheduled departure times of the first and last journeys, which may start from either end of the route — check the timetable above for times at your own stop.
Does the 27 bus run at weekends?
Yes. The 27 runs seven days a week, including Saturdays and Sundays. Sunday and bank holiday timetables are usually less frequent than weekdays, so check the times above before travelling.
How long does the 27 bus take?
A full end-to-end journey on the 27 takes about 72 minutes between Solihull Town Centre and Rubery, Great Park, running via Alcester Lanes End and Bournville. Allow extra time at peak periods — this is the scheduled running time, not a guarantee.
